Another big bad knife from Cold Steel. I've always loved these big folding Cold Steel blades as real men should. We'll again see how the Chinese knife industry with their original and well made designs are making it tough for the big knife companies. Cold Steel will be just fine though. That's because they continue to make knives like the Luzon: incredible size, quality, and value you'll get from the Luzon series, both 4" and 6" versions reviewed here. They feature an exterior lock to prevent closure of the liner lock. Don't expect TriAd lockup strength with this but it's a nice feature that can be ignored if you don't like it. Add in good blade steel, long comfortable handle, perfect blade finishing, molded in clip, and waveable from the pocket (!). What's not to like (ok maybe the fart).

I have approximately 8 months of edc use at work with the 6". The steel is sub par and thin, and comes with a very rapidly dulled extreme razor edge. It is not ideal for chores. It is however very resistant to chipping or snapping, and extremely thin sharp and pointy. It is tailor made for maximum legal weapon potential in a place with oppressive laws. My opinion is that as is typical of Lynn Thompson's work, it is a highly refined and very affordable purpose built precision uncompromising weapon, nothing more or less. If you want a work knife in this size, thicker and better steel is what you want, not this. Want an optimal single edge folding fighter? Here it is.
